The Evolution of Tofu Filters

The traditional method of filtering soy milk using cloth is labor-intensive and prone to inconsistencies. This has led to the development of various alternative tofu filters, each with its own advantages and disadvantages. Early innovations focused on replacing cloth with more durable materials like nylon mesh or stainless steel screens. These materials offered improved durability and ease of cleaning, but they still required manual operation and were susceptible to clogging.

Technological Advancements in Tofu Filtration

The advent of modern technology has brought about significant advancements in tofu filtration. Automated systems have been developed, incorporating features like pressure filtration, vacuum filtration, and centrifugal separation. These systems offer increased efficiency, reduced labor requirements, and improved consistency in tofu production. Pressure filtration, for instance, utilizes pressure to force soy milk through a filter, resulting in faster filtration and higher yields. Vacuum filtration, on the other hand, uses a vacuum to draw soy milk through a filter, minimizing the risk of clogging. Centrifugal separation, meanwhile, utilizes centrifugal force to separate the soy milk from the solids, offering a highly efficient and automated solution.

The Impact of Innovation on Tofu Quality

The use of innovative tofu filters has a direct impact on the quality of the final product. Improved filtration techniques lead to a smoother texture, reduced bitterness, and a more consistent tofu product. The removal of impurities during filtration also contributes to a longer shelf life and improved nutritional value. Furthermore, the use of automated systems allows for greater control over the filtration process, resulting in a more standardized and predictable product.

Future Directions in Tofu Filter Development

The field of tofu filter innovation continues to evolve, with ongoing research and development focused on further improving efficiency, sustainability, and product quality. One promising area of research involves the use of nanotechnology to create highly porous and efficient filters. Another area of focus is the development of filters that can be easily cleaned and reused, reducing waste and promoting sustainability.
